9 Israelis lightly injured by Gaza rocket fire

JERUSALEM 

Israel's national ambulance service said Tuesday its paramedics had treated nine Israelis from 'minor injuries' sustained from rockets fired from the Gaza Strip into central Israel.

The ambulance service, however, did not clarify the nature of the injuries.

Earlier on Tuesday, the Israeli army said one rocket from Gaza had hit the central Yehud city while the Iron Dome anti-missile defense system intercepted another targeting Tel Aviv.

Mickey Rosenfeld, Israeli police spokesman, tweeted that the rocket fired on Yehud had caused damage, without specifying the nature thereof.

Israeli security forces also announced earlier that one rocket had fallen on the southern city of Ashdod while seven others had been intercepted by the Iron Dome.

Israel says 2060 rockets have been fired from Gaza since the beginning of its military offensive against Gaza, according to a statement on Tuesday.

Two Israelis have been killed by Gaza rocket fire.

Gaza-based resistance factions have continued to fire rockets at Israeli cities in response to the ongoing Israeli assault, which left at least 583 Palestinians – mostly civilians – dead and more than 3550 injured since July 7.

Israel's military operation, dubbed "Operation Protective Edge," is the self-proclaimed Jewish state's third major offensive against the densely-populated Gaza Strip – which is home to some 1.8 million Palestinians – within the last six years.
